Output 5fb58f6e87676243d09eba4f8016e14a975569fe4a4845f54de8fdc9a42e26a5:5

value
140796392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61cc672784918edcd852f4e0a5f479471c6fb0e OP_EQUAL
address
3KkYBrtjjpJmdfx4iTtirF32gTymdpKP1T
transaction
5fb58f6e87676243d09eba4f8016e14a975569fe4a4845f54de8fdc9a42e26a5
spent
true